Output 21afe4144e622e93a2783ae2d98b33692817353e16fd8be33a5ec6ee66b95955:0

value
6176068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c756645b0bff3a20dad16bea3f59c1fbb2ebe7e OP_EQUAL
address
3D36MPdkLMhL6dfGS1qYFjMESFPpC615jp
transaction
21afe4144e622e93a2783ae2d98b33692817353e16fd8be33a5ec6ee66b95955
spent
true